Congratualtions!!!! You won't be disappointed. I have some clever friends that modified the wing tips to use the tanks on the Mav Pro. The tip tanks mount on a flat plate on the wing tips. (The tips are just squared off) What they did was to make the rounded tip removable. When you wanted tip tanks just remove the rounded tips. Both the tanks and the tips used the same mounting system.
